2. Product Parameters
Parameter | Specification |
---|---|
Model | TA524 1SAP180600R0001 |
Brand | ABB |
Voltage | 24 V DC (±10%) |
Current Consumption | ≤500 mA |
Interface | Ethernet/IP, Modbus TCP, Profibus DP |
Input/Output Channels | 16 digital inputs/16 digital outputs |
Compatibility | ABB AC500, AC800M, and 第三方 PLC systems |
Operating Temperature | -20°C to +60°C |
Dimensions (W×H×D) | 100 mm × 125 mm × 100 mm |
